DIRECTIONS
By plane
From Rome’s “Leonardo Da Vinci” or “Ciampino” airports you can take a taxi. We recommend you do not accept rides from taxis without taximeter. The trip from the airport takes around 50 minutes. Another possibility is the “Leonardo Express” train, which leaves from the Fiumicino airport every 30 minutes and reaches Termini railway station in around 35 minutes. Tickets cost 15 euros per person.
By train
From Termini Station you can get to Hotel Ranieri by taxi: the trip takes around 5 minutes and costs approximately 10 euro. Another possibility is to take bus no. 16 to Via Venti Settembre. If you do not have heavy luggage, you can also reach us on foot in 10-15 minutes.
By car
Take the Roma Nord motorway exit and continue for about 19 km until the GRA (Grande Raccordo Anulare – Rome’s ring road). After about 5 km take exit no. 11 on the GRA for Via Nomentana and head towards the centre. Continue for around 9 km on this road: stay in the right lane and avoid the underpass and continue going straight until the traffic light. Go through the walls at Porta Pia and drive down Via Venti Settembre, after around 250 metres you’ll see the Hotel’s vertical sign on the right. Your car can be parked upon request in a nearby garage with pick-up and delivery service. The cost varies based on the dimensions of the car starting from 30 euros for 24 hours.
